Veracyte SD, Inc.
Veracyte SD, Inc. Miscellaneous Commercial ServicesCommercial Services Decipher Biosciences, Inc. is a commercial-stage precision oncology company which engages in patient care improvement. The Company?s differentiated approach measures the biological activity of a patient?s entire tumor genome, known as whole transcriptome analysis, and applies proprietary machine learning algorithms to improve therapy selection and accelerate adoption of new therapies into the standard of care. Its novel prostate cancer genomic testing products examine the underlying biology of a patient?s tumor, enabling physicians to select an optimal therapy. The firm?s whole transcriptome analysis of clinical patient samples from its commercial channel and its participation in practice-changing clinical trials has allowed it to build and expand its Decipher GRID database GRID. The company was founded by Elai Davicioni, Timothy J. Triche, Bruce A. Schmidt, and Jonathan D. Buckley and is headquartered in San Diego, CA. | Miscellaneous Commercial Services | Chairman Chief Executive Officer Director of Finance/CFO | |

Delfi Diagnostics, Inc.
Delfi Diagnostics, Inc. Medical/Nursing ServicesHealth Services Delfi Diagnostics, Inc. engages in the development of blood test for detection and interception of cancer. It uses artificial intelligence and whole genome sequencing to detect patterns of DNA fragmentation in the blood of patients with cancer. The company is headquartered in Baltimore, MD. | Medical/Nursing Services | Consultant / Advisor Chief Executive Officer Director/Board Member |
